DSV Expands Semiconductor Logistics and Latin America Operations

Danish logistics giant DSV has acquired US-based S&M Moving Systems West and Global Diversity Logistics. This strategic move aims to strengthen DSV's position in the semiconductor industry, optimize operations at Phoenix Airport, and expand cross-border services in Latin America. The acquisition will significantly broaden DSV's operational footprint within the United States and enhance its global network and overall service capabilities. It represents a key step in DSV's continued growth strategy and commitment to providing comprehensive logistics solutions.

Burkina Faso Adopts Wcos Modernized Customs System to Enhance Trade

The World Customs Organization (WCO), with funding from the Swedish government through the West Africa Customs Modernization Project (MADAO), held a capacity building workshop on the Harmonized System (HS) and Advance Ruling for Burkina Faso Customs. The workshop aimed to enhance the professional skills of Burkina Faso Customs officials, assist the country in establishing an efficient and transparent advance ruling system, improve trade facilitation, and attract foreign investment. This initiative supports Burkina Faso's efforts to modernize its customs procedures and promote economic growth.
